PWSID: CO0235185 · Estes Park, CO · Serves 260 people
According to EPA Safe Drinking Water Information System (SDWIS), ANNUNCIATION HEIGHTS (PWSID CO0235185) in Estes Park, CO is listed as a CWS water system covering about 260 people. The same extract lists 47 health-based violation records spanning 2014-2024. Those 47 health-based rows for ANNUNCIATION HEIGHTS cover contaminants such as TTHM, Gross Alpha, Excl. Radon and U, Combined Radium (-226 and -228); they remain historical EPA registry entries, not a current compliance or drinkability score.

PlainEnviro's health-based SDWIS extract covers monitoring and reporting violations only -- it does not include unresolved enforcement actions in progress or corrective steps a utility has taken since the extract date. 5 distinct EPA contaminant codes appear in this system's record, including TTHM, Gross Alpha, Excl. Radon and U, Combined Radium (-226 and -228). Recorded violations span 2014–2024. Day-to-day primacy enforcement for this system runs through the Colorado drinking-water program, not EPA directly.
A historical health-based record does not necessarily describe current water quality or compliance. The most authoritative current source is the utility's annual Consumer Confidence Report. For enforcement history and corrective-action orders, consult EPA ECHO and the Colorado state drinking-water program's public portal.
